Who is the proponent of Electon

Joseph John Thomson

Who is the Proponent of Proton

Eugene Goldstein

Symbol for Compound

Shorthand

Who is the proponent of neutron

James Chadwick

Made from the symbol of their elements in a pattern that shows the ratios of atoms present in the compound

Chemical Formula

based on the actual number of atoms that comprise molecule of that a compound.

Molecular Formula

reflects the simplest ratio of atoms in the compound

Emperical Formula

of symbols to represent atoms, and lines or bond to represent valence

Structural Formula

shows the distribution of electron in the outermost shell of the atom as the atoms are united to each other

Lewis Electron Formula

What is the Charge Coulomb of Electron?

-1.602x10-¹⁹

What is The Charge Coloumb of Proton?

1.602x10-¹⁹

What is the charge coloumb neutron?

0

What is the Mass(gram) of Electron?

9.108x10-²⁸

What is the Mass (gram) of Proton

1.673x10-²⁴

What is the mass gram of Neutron?

1.675x10-²⁴
